A primary consideration for many in Scipio Center is the blend of personalized service and modern convenience. Cayuga Bank, with its deep roots in the Finger Lakes region, is a standout choice. While you won't find a branch directly in Scipio Center, their presence in nearby Auburn provides a full-service location that feels community-oriented. They are known for understanding the financial needs of rural and small-town residents, from agricultural lending to personal savings accounts. For routine transactions, it’s wise to check their online and mobile banking capabilities to minimize trips.
Another robust option is Community Bank, N.A., which also has a strong branch network in the region, including locations in Auburn and Union Springs. They offer a wide array of services, from checking accounts to mortgage lending, and their reputation for stability is a significant plus. If your banking needs include frequent cash deposits or in-person consultations, planning a trip to one of these nearby branches is a straightforward part of your errand routine. Be sure to review their specific hours, as some locations may have tailored schedules.
For those seeking a member-focused alternative, Empower Federal Credit Union is a fantastic local resource. As a credit union, they prioritize serving their members with often more favorable rates and lower fees. They have a branch in Auburn and are part of extensive shared branching and ATM networks. This can be particularly valuable; you might find you can conduct certain transactions at other local credit union outlets, adding a layer of convenience. Exploring membership eligibility, which is often based on living in a specific county, is your first step.
